Energy Effectiveness and Renewable Resource Solutions



While lots of designers concentrate on aesthetics, prioritizing power performance and eco-friendly power remedies is essential for lasting layout. You can begin by integrating easy solar style, which enhances natural light and heat, reducing dependence on fabricated lights and heating unit. Use high-performance get more info insulation and energy-efficient windows to minimize power loss.




Do not ignore renewable power systems-- set up solar panels or wind turbines to create tidy power on-site. You can additionally take into consideration integrating geothermal heating and cooling down systems for a much more sustainable temperature guideline.


By choosing energy-efficient home appliances and illumination, you'll not just minimize power intake but also reduced functional prices for constructing owners.

Water Conservation Approaches in Modern Design



Incorporating water preservation strategies right into modern design is important for developing sustainable structures that minimize environmental influence. You can achieve this by incorporating rain harvesting click here systems, which gather and save rainfall for watering and non-potable usages. Implementing low-flow fixtures and clever irrigation systems likewise reduces water consumption, making certain efficient usage throughout the structure.


Take into consideration utilizing drought-resistant landscape design, which calls for less water and promotes biodiversity. Integrating absorptive paving products allows rainwater to infiltrate the ground, decreasing drainage and reenergizing groundwater supplies.


Furthermore, setting up greywater recycling systems can repurpose water from sinks and showers for commode flushing or watering, further conserving resources.
